Continuous Feed Garbage Disposals
Continuous feed garbage disposals are the most common type found in residential kitchens. They are designed to handle food waste continuously, allowing users to feed them constantly while the device is running. This type of disposal operates by using a constant flow of cold water to help move the food particles through the grinding chamber and down into the drain pipes.
How Continuous Feed Disposals Work
The operation of a continuous feed disposal is relatively straightforward. When you turn it on, the disposal’s grinding blades begin to spin, creating a vortex that pulls food waste down into the grinding chamber. Cold water, which should be running throughout the disposal’s operation, helps to cool the motor, reduce friction, and carry the ground food particles away from the disposal into the plumbing system. The grinding action is typically driven by an electric motor, with the power varying depending on the model, from a fraction of a horsepower for basic models to over a horsepower for heavy-duty disposals.
Advantages and Considerations
Continuous feed disposals offer several advantages, including ease of use and the ability to handle a significant amount of food waste at once. However, they also come with some considerations. They require careful handling to avoid jams or damage from hard objects. Moreover, without proper maintenance, such as regular cleaning and checks for blockages, these disposals can lead to bad odors and efficiency issues.
Batch Feed Garbage Disposals
Batch feed garbage disposals, on the other hand, operate on a different principle. They require you to feed them a “batch” of food waste at a time, and then you must activate them, usually by placing a stopper over the drain opening and turning the disposal on. This type of disposal is designed with safety and efficiency in mind, particularly suited for households with young children or pets, as they minimize the risk of accidental start-ups.
Operational Overview
The operational process of a batch feed disposal starts with filling the disposal’s grinding chamber with food waste. Once the chamber is filled, the user places a special stopper over the drain opening and turns on the disposal. The stopper acts as a safety feature, ensuring the disposal only operates when the chamber is fully covered, preventing any foreign objects or body parts from entering the grinding area. After grinding the waste, the disposal is turned off, and the stopper is removed, allowing the finely ground waste to be washed away with cold water.
Benefits and Drawbacks
Batch feed disposals offer enhanced safety features and can be more energy-efficient since they only operate when needed. However, they may require more effort and time to use, as you need to wait for the disposal to grind each batch before adding more waste. This can be less convenient for large families or during periods of heavy food preparation.

What are the key differences between continuous feed and batch feed garbage disposals in terms of installation and maintenance?
The installation process for continuous feed and batch feed garbage disposals differs slightly. Continuous feed disposals require a dedicated electrical connection and a switch to operate, whereas batch feed disposals typically use a magnetic or electronic cover to activate the disposal. In terms of maintenance, continuous feed disposals require regular cleaning and grease removal to prevent clogging and odors. Batch feed disposals also require regular maintenance, including cleaning and checking the magnetic cover for proper alignment. Additionally, batch feed disposals may require more frequent maintenance due to the stop-and-go operation, which can lead to increased wear and tear on the disposal.
Regular maintenance is crucial for both types of garbage disposals to ensure they operate effectively and efficiently. Homeowners should run cold water through the disposal during and after use, and also perform routine cleaning and checks to prevent clogs and odors. For continuous feed disposals, it is essential to be mindful of the types of food waste being disposed of, as certain items like bones, seeds, and potato peels can cause damage or clog the disposal. For batch feed disposals, users should ensure the magnetic cover is functioning correctly and that the disposal is properly aligned with the sink drain to prevent leaks and clogs.
